Abstract
Training machine learning systems using a training data set, gradient descent, and a loss function. The machine learning system includes memory and reads and writes to memory according to read and write profiles. The loss function is associated with machine learning system memory read and write profile gradients. The loss function includes a loss function penalty term, the loss function penalty term being associated with the read and write profile gradient differences. Trained machine learning systems are then provided.
